When we step onto the mat for the sake of others, our personal movement becomes a quiet catalyst for collective harmony. In Season 8, Episode 5 of Yoga Every Day, instructor Nichole Golden leads a compassionate yoga practice designed to shift your perspective from self-centered effort to outward service. This 20-minute hatha yoga level 1-2 session uses heart opening backbends to release physical tension and cultivate emotional availability. By establishing this morning yoga ritual, you learn to recognize how your inner state directly influences the people and environments around you.

The physical practice of Hatha yoga serves as a mirror for our daily lives. When we focus on opening the chest and thoracic spine, we are not merely stretching muscles; we are actively dismantling the protective armor we carry throughout the day. This intentional opening allows us to approach our relationships with greater empathy and presence. Throughout this session, you will be guided through gentle yet profound movements that encourage a state of receptive awareness, preparing you to meet the world with an open heart.

Hatha yoga emphasizes the balance of active effort and receptive surrender. By balancing these dual energies on the mat, we cultivate the stability needed to support those around us. This practice invites you to move beyond the physical boundaries of your mat, recognizing that every breath you take and every posture you hold has a ripple effect on the world. Using a simple blanket for support, you will navigate foundational postures that build strength, flexibility, and a deep sense of inner peace.

Whether you are looking to start your day with clear intention or seeking to deepen your understanding of living for the sake of others, this practice offers a grounded approach to embodied mindfulness.
